Stop by the American Legion this Fourth of July to connect with the Veterans Mental Health Council during Columbia’s celebration of America’s 250th Birthday.
This community outreach event is focused on supporting veterans through connection, suicide prevention, and practical safety resources. Whether you’re a veteran, family member, or supporter, you’re invited to stop by, ask questions, and learn more about available services.
π
Saturday, July 4
π American Legion Post 202
3669 Legion Lane, Columbia, MO
Visitors can:
- πΊπΈ Connect with the Veterans Mental Health Council team
- π Learn about local veteran mental health resources
- π Receive free gun locks as part of the organization’s safety outreach
- π’ Experience 44 Boots, 44 Stories, a meaningful exhibit honoring the lives and stories of veterans
The event highlights the importance of community, awareness, and support for those who have served. Stop by, bring a friend, and help promote veteran wellness while enjoying the day’s Independence Day festivities.
If you or someone you love is in crisis, call or text 988 and press 1 for the Veterans Crisis Line.
